Do you live a life of integrity?

78:72 Psalm “And David shepherded them with integrity of heart; with skillful hands he led them.” (NIV)

What kind of leader are you? Many would argue that they aren’t leaders… I would beg to differ with that assessment. You may not have a title or position to lead BUT you can still lead others to know Jesus. That is the most critical leadership role that exists. Your life of integrity sets an example that others want to follow… that’s leadership. Your acts of kindness and service becomes the model of real living that friends and family want to emulate… that’s leadership. So, lead from the heart and use skillful hands to pass on His love to those who are watching and waiting for your leadership!
